One of the few speciality cafes in the heart of Mississippi. The founders have connections to Black and White, so you’re sure to find high quality coffee here. The milk drinks truly are expertly crafted at Native, and as it currently stands, this is my #1 coffee shop in Mississippi.

Relatively new to the area, Northshore was a delight to see added to Mississippi’s capitol area. To be honest, I haven’t had a milk drink yet, as I’ve only had pour overs on my visits. However, Northshore is roasting up a nice menu of medium to light roast beans. Recently had a Colombian processed with Osmotic Dehydration (was new to me lol), and it was nice and smooth with some punchy mango to finish. Location is a bit odd (under a complex) but nice vibes for where it is!

Tamper Specialty Coffee

Tamper is technically in Madison, slightly north of Jackson. Also in an odd location (strip mall), I was pleasantly surprised! Lots of seating, nice minimal design, and good coffee. I didn’t anticipate Madison having a shop that cared about single origin light roasts, but here we are. Not the most mind blowing milk drinks, but definitely meets the need. Bonus fun: you can order Chemex and Aeropress.
